Job overview
The Finance Manager at Luther Automotive Group is responsible for facilitating customer financing and enhancing their vehicle ownership experience, contributing to the profitability of the dealership.
Responsibilities and impact
Daily responsibilities include structuring deals for profitability, ensuring compliance with regulations, preparing paperwork, and auditing team deals post-sale.
Compensation and benefits
The salary range for this position is $90-130k per year, along with benefits including medical, dental, vision, disability, 401k with match, HSA, life insurance, paid vacation, employee discounts, and growth opportunities.
Experience and skills
Candidates should have a college degree or equivalent experience, knowledge of dealership finance and insurance procedures, and strong communication and negotiation skills.

Company overview
Luther Automotive Group is a leading automotive dealership network based in the United States, specializing in the sale of new and pre-owned vehicles, as well as offering financing, leasing, and automotive repair services. Founded in 1952, the company has grown to operate over 30 dealerships across multiple states, representing a wide range of major automotive brands. It generates revenue through vehicle sales, service and parts departments, and financial services, including loans and warranties. Known for its customer-focused approach, Luther Automotive emphasizes community involvement and employee development, making it a reputable and stable organization in the automotive retail industry.
